Imagine you are willing to invest $20000 and you have two choices:

a) A safe investment that promises to pay 5% profit after 1 year.

b) A risky investment that has a 20% chance you might lose half of your money.

1) How much do you expect to get paid for a year in the second investment to be indifferent between two investment choices? (The two investments have the same Expected Profit)

 

2) What is the Risk Premium in the second choices?
